WitrynaTherapeutic cloning, also known as somatic cell nuclear transfer (SCNT) is permitted in Australia under a licence issued by the NHMRC Embryo Research Licensing Committee. The aim is to create a cloned embryo and then to derive an embryonic stem cell line that could be used for research. SCNT was the technique used to create the first cloned ... WitrynaMesenchymal stem cells are a subgroup of stem cells. Mesenchymal stem cells are multipotent, meaning that they can produce more than one type of specialised cell, but not all types of specialised cells. Witryna18 paź 2011 · The UK permits embryonic stem cell research, up to 14 days gestation.
